        "content": "<p>&apos;Police officers should set good example first&apos;<\/p>\n<p>The city police have warned the public of the presence of bogus<br>\npolice officers who pose as real police officers, cheating and<br>\nextorting money from their victims, mostly motorists. The Jakarta<br>\nPost talked to some residents over the issue.<\/p>\n<p>Adul, 36, is a multi-level marketing executive who resides in<br>\nCipulir, Tangerang. He lives with his wife and two children:<\/p>\n<p>I think the bogus police officers should not be tolerated<br>\nbecause they will tarnish the image of the city police in<br>\ngeneral.<\/p>\n<p>They are able to operate perhaps due to people&apos;s laziness or<br>\nreluctance to demand to see some identification of the officers.<br>\nGenerally speaking, we do not have the guts to ask such questions<br>\nbecause of the stern image of police officers who are on duty.<\/p>\n<p>However, it doesn&apos;t mean that we should just take their orders<br>\nfor granted in cases where we are sure that we have not violated<br>\ntraffic regulations.<\/p>\n<p>If I am stopped, I will dare to ask the officers to produce<br>\nsome identification. Even when I&apos;m aware that I have violated a<br>\ntraffic regulation, I would still ask them.<\/p>\n<p>If they are bogus officers, I would seek the help of friends<br>\nto beat up those tricksters.<\/p>\n<p>To tell the truth, I sometimes play games with police officers<br>\nby going through a red light to challenge them to chase after me.<br>\nI&apos;m not afraid because I will pay them in the usual &apos;amicable<br>\nway&apos;, after all. At least, I have made them busy pursuing me.<\/p>\n<p>The presence of such bogus officers cannot be separated from<br>\nthe presence of real ill-behaved police officers on the street,<br>\nincluding those who illegally extort money from traffic<br>\nviolators.<\/p>\n<p>Therefore, they (real police) should learn to set a good<br>\nexample for the public.<\/p>\n<p>Yanto, 21, is a construction worker who rents a house together<br>\nwith his colleagues in Cengkareng, West Jakarta.:<\/p>\n<p>I have watched many cases of bogus police officers on<br>\ntelevision. I believe there are many people posing as police<br>\nofficers around the city.<\/p>\n<p>My friend told me that he was riding his motorcycle along with<br>\na friend of his when they were stopped by people in police<br>\nuniforms on a quiet street one night. He was asked to surrender<br>\nhis motorcycle for not wearing a helmet at the time.<\/p>\n<p>He gave the motorcycle only to realize later that he had been<br>\nrobbed by those guys posing as police officers.<\/p>\n<p>I agree with those who say that those impostors should just be<br>\nbeaten up if they are caught red-handed by the public.<\/p>\n<p>Even if they are true police or military officers, but if they<br>\nthreaten public security, they should be punished harshly. We<br>\n(Cengkareng residents) have mobbed a bogus police officer who<br>\ntried to extort money from someone near my house.<\/p>\n<p>Well, I can understand, in a way, that now underprivileged<br>\npeople are finding smarter ways to earn money in these times of<br>\neconomic hardship. Still, they are no different from bandits.<\/p>\n<p>It is possible to purchase military and police uniforms in<br>\nseveral places in the city. Their physique sometimes makes it<br>\nhard to distinguish between real officers and bogus ones. But, we<br>\nhave to dare to ask them for identification to confirm their<br>\nidentity.<\/p>\n<p>The police should join hands with the public in cracking down<br>\non those bogus officers. Otherwise the image of the police will<br>\nbe damaged.<\/p>\n<p>Pawang Widjaya, 31, is a freelance translator who resides in<br>\nUtan Kayu, East Jakarta with his wife and daughter:<\/p>\n<p>I guess the bogus police officers are a real embarrassment for<br>\nthe city police, especially considering that the police have been<br>\ntrying hard to improve their public image.<\/p>\n<p>I pity them because they have not yet successfully cracked<br>\ndown on thugs operating in Greater Jakarta. They have not made<br>\ncity residents feel secure about going out in the city, even more<br>\nso now with the presence of those tricksters.<\/p>\n<p>Honestly, I think twice about taking a ride on a public buses<br>\nor even by motorcycle taxi. It&apos;s better for me to travel by taxi,<br>\nin spite of the expense.<\/p>\n<p>I regret that many people are able to buy police uniforms,<br>\nmaking it easy for them to masquerade as real officers. I also<br>\nregret the fact that many police officers frequently extort money<br>\nfrom drivers for violating traffic regulations. Such actions have<br>\nset a bad example for the public to emulate.<\/p>\n<p>On the other hand, many city residents deliberately violate<br>\ntraffic regulations. Their undisciplined attitude is one of the<br>\nfactors that provokes police officers to teach a lesson to the<br>\nviolators.<\/p>\n<p>I&apos;m of the opinion that we have to work hand in hand to combat<br>\nthem, or otherwise their numbers will increase.<\/p>",
